644:
645:
646: # ------------- usage / argument handling --------------
647: def usage(actions, msg=None):
648: name = os.path.basename(sys.argv[0])
649: uiname = "%s %s" % (UInfo.name, UInfo.version)
650: print "\n%s" % uiname
651: print "=" * len(uiname)
652: print "\nUsage: %s [options] [floppy image]" % name
653: print "\nOptions:"
654: print "\t-h, --help\t\tthis help"
655: print "\t-n, --nomenu\t\tomit menus"
656: print "\t-e, --embed\t\tembed Hatari window in middle of controls"
657: print "\t-f, --fullscreen\tstart in fullscreen"
658: print "\t-l, --left <controls>\ttoolbar at left"
659: print "\t-r, --right <controls>\ttoolbar at right"
660: print "\t-t, --top <controls>\ttoolbar at top"
661: print "\t-b, --bottom <controls>\ttoolbar at bottom"
662: print "\t-p, --panel <name>,<controls>"
663: print "\t\t\t\tseparate window with given name and controls"
664: print "\nAvailable (toolbar) controls:"
665: for action, description in actions.list_actions():
666: size = len(action)
667: if size < 8:
668: tabs = "\t\t"
669: elif size < 16:
670: tabs = "\t"
671: else:
672: tabs = "\n\t\t\t"
673: print "\t%s%s%s" % (action, tabs, description)
674: print """
675: You can have as many panels as you wish. For each panel you need to add
676: a control with the name of the panel (see "MyPanel" below).
677:
678: For example:
679: \t%s --embed \\
680: \t-t "about,run,pause,quit" \\
681: \t-p "MyPanel,Macro=Test,Undo=97,Help=98,>,F1=59,F2=60,F3=61,F4=62,>,close" \\
682: \t-r "paste,debug,trace,machine,MyPanel" \\
683: \t-b "sound,|,fastforward,|,fullscreen"
684:
685: if no options are given, the UI uses basic controls.
686: """ % name
687: if msg:
688: print "ERROR: %s\n" % msg
